S20 Week 1 Recap - Goalies Edition!

    Hello all, I couldn't let @lm Deanoo be the only one producing goalie content so here I am giving it a go. The more support this gets, the more likely I am to continue this or maybe even focus on other positions.

    :team31: Anaheim Ducks :team31:

    Starter: @Benzymcnasty 3-2-1 .793 save % 1.83GAA with 58 shots against, 12 goals allowed.
    Backup: @Bxlchy 3-0-0 .786 save % 1.68GAA with 28 shots against, 6 goals allowed.


    Honestly, Anaheim should be pretty content with both their goalies' performances this week. Benzy himself is a stud and Bxlchy should be able to stay consistent if they can get more 3v3s going. They did pay Bxlchy 2.25m this season so I can see him being shipped off for a more suitable "backup" for cheaper.

    :team28: Arizona Coyotes :team28:

    Starter: @ll GOHST ll 4-2-0 .792 save % 2.42GAA with 72 shots against, 15 goals allowed.
    Backup: @Polar-1387 1-1-1 .767 save % 2.16GAA with 30 shots against, 7 goals allowed.


    Arizona is projected to be one of the better teams in the league so naturally their goalies should have above-average stats. I'd personally like to see a lil bit better performances from their goalies but in the big picture, it's not awful. Gohst saw two games this week where he faced 20 shots, not bad!

    :team2: Boston Bruins :team2:

    Starter: @Swaymxn- 5-1-0 .849 save % 1.49GAA with 73 shots against, 11 goals allowed.
    Backup @xChoo-_- (Did not play this week and not going to look up the ecu stats.)


    Tommy should be very happy with Swayman's performance this week. Some very nice numbers this week and at a bargain price of 1.5m. How did he not get player of the week lol. Boston is also a team that is going to be at the top of the standings therefore his stats should look good.

    :team18: Buffalo Sabres :team18:

    Starter: @KROFTONITE 5-1-0 .755 save % 2.00GAA with 49 shots against, 12 goals allowed.
    Backup: @YuNgWuN413 2-1-0 .810 save % 2.67GAA with 42 shots against, 8 goals allowed.


    I'd like to see a better performance out of Krofto and I'm sure he'd agree. He faced a very mediocre 49 shots through 6 games. He knows he can do better and most likely will this week. Yung almost faced the same amount of shots through 3 games and had some decent stats this week.

    :team29: Calgary Flames :team29:

    Starter: @Vulkihn 5-0-1 .800 save % 1.89GAA with 60 shots against, 12 goals allowed.
    Starter: @Serrrvz- 0-3-0 .667 save % 6.00GAA with 54 shots against, 18 goals allowed. (with OTT)


    Vulk is my boy and produced this week as he should on a defense-heavy team. He is on the IR this week therefore assuming Servs will take over the starting role after being traded for. Servs has some awful stats but was stuck on an awful team in Ottawa so I fully expect a 360 with his stats this week. After playing against him in drafts, Servs is pretty good and can easily take the starting role from Vulk should Vulk start to struggle.

    :team74: Carolina Hurricanes :team74:

    Starter: @GoNicsGo95 2-2-2 .824 save % 2.23GAA with 85 shots against, 15 goals allowed.
    Backup: @ItsAntt-_- 2-1-0 .872 save % 1.51GAA with 39 shots against, 5 goals allowed.


    Honestly, if I'm Josh, I'm very happy with the goalie's performances. Nics is a stud and performed as he was expected to. Even though our wonderful GM @McLxvinn couldn't help him and win a game! I won't say much about mine but I performed pretty well with our 3rd line, against two other third lines. Nics faced an abnormally high amount of shots so hopefully we can get that under control! Go Canes!

    :team75: Chicago Blackhawks :team75:

    Starter: @TerryOh_ 4-2-0 .808 save % 2.19GAA with 78 shots against, 15 goals allowed.
    Backup: @xSmirta 1-2-0 .811 save % 3.19GAA with 53 shots against, 10 goals allowed.


    I feel like Terry gets trolled in the sb and is becoming a meme but he put up some decent stats on an average team. He stayed busy with 78 shots against but should continue the same performance level. Smirta is a cool dude and also produced decent stats. Chicago should be content with this tandem.

    :team8: Colorado Avalanche :team8:

    Starter: @YourFriendBR 3-1-2 .833 save % 1.77GAA with 72 shots against, 12 goals allowed.
    Backup: @iAm-Beasti 0-3-0 .717 save % 4.33GAA with 46 shots against, 13 goals allowed.


    BR produced some very well stats and from what I've heard, that's the normal for him. Look for him to keep up the same stats. Beasti struggled but it was justified. He played with their third line against lines that looked like they weren't third liners. Hopefully Greggy can set up some 3v3s otherwise it'll be a long season for the AGM and he might want to trade himself!

    :team6: Columbus Blue Jackets :team6:

    Starter: @xLeafs33 3-2-1 .819 save % 2.21GAA with 83 shots against, 15 goals allowed.
    Backup: @Doc_Peep 3-0-0 .903 save % 1.00GAA with 31 shots against, 3 goals allowed.


    Leafs, in my opinion, has been a consistent goalie for awhile now and this season is no different. He performed nicely and CBJ should be happy with him. Doc won player of the week this week for his performance and I feel it was somewhat deserved. He only faced 31 shots.     Notable Accolades:

    Most goals allowed: @Debrxsk & @TapzoutTV with 22 goals.
    Most shots faced: EASILY @TMGKuzKuz31 with 81 through 3 games.
    Fewest shots faced: @dudethisishard with 24 through 3 games.
    Fewest goals allowed: @Doc_Peep & @zachsnhl with 3 goals each.
